Forecasting Conceptual Diffusion in Science: The Case of Quantum Computing
LightGBM models on citation and diversity features predict exogenous diffusion of quantum computing concepts with R² up to 0.78 while endogenous reinforcement remains largely unpredictable after growth controls, with replications in other fields.

A process-based dynamic occupancy model to study range dynamics under non-equilibrium conditions
A new process-based dynamic occupancy model with dispersal-pressure colonization and sparse matrices enables large-scale study of range dynamics and disentangles dispersal from habitat effects in non-equilibrium conditions.

Unmasking LAION-5B: Age, Gender, Race, and Emotion Biases in Large-Scale Image Datasets
Empirical audit of LAION-2B-en and LAION-2B-multi finds overrepresentation of young adults, White people, and males plus stereotypical emotion associations across two attribute classifiers.

Thinking Like a Scientist? A Structural Study of LLM-Generated Research Methods
LLMs given only research questions from 1000 arXiv CS papers recommend a narrower set of methods than the original papers, with effective model-entity diversity dropping from 1232 to 59-96 and stronger agreement among LLMs than with papers.

Explainable Forecasting of Scientific Breakthroughs from Concept Network Dynamics
A two-stage LightGBM model on 59 features from concept networks forecasts link formation and intensity with ROC-AUC 0.95-0.967 across domains.
